Spring Roofing Upkeep



When springtime shows up, it's important to evaluate your roof for any kind of damages or wear that may have occurred during the winter months. Start by taking a look at the shingles for any indications of fracturing, curling, or missing items. These could suggest water damages or aging roof shingles that require changing.

Look for any loosened or damaged blinking around chimneys, vents, and skylights, as these can result in leakages otherwise correctly sealed.

Clear out rain gutters and downspouts from debris like fallen leaves and twigs to guarantee appropriate water drainage and stop water build-up on the roofing.

Trim any kind of overhanging branches that might potentially harm your roofing system during strong winds or tornados.

Finally, take a look at the attic for indicators of water stains, mold and mildew, or mold, as these can indicate a leakage in your roofing.

Summer Roofing Care



During the summer season, maintaining your roof covering is essential to guarantee it holds up against the heat and possible weather difficulties. Start by getting rid of any kind of debris like fallen leaves, branches, and dust from the roof surface and seamless gutters.

The scorching sunlight can create tiles to warp or crack, so inspect them for any type of damages and change as required. Check for indicators of algae or moss growth, specifically in shaded areas, and tidy them to stop wetness retention.


Cut looming tree branches to avoid them massaging against the roof during summertime tornados. Additionally, inspect the flashing around smokeshafts, vents, and skylights for any voids or damage that might result in leaks.

Winter Season Roof Covering Inspection



Prepare your roofing for the winter season by conducting an extensive evaluation to ensure it can hold up against the winter and prospective snow or ice buildup. Begin by taking a look at the shingles for any kind of indicators of damages or wear. Look for fractures, missing items, or curling sides that could cause leakages.

Inspect the flashing around chimneys, vents, and skylights to ensure they're safe and sealed effectively. Clear any debris like leaves or branches that can obstruct water drainage and cause water accumulation. Evaluate the gutters for blockages and see to it they're firmly attached to the roofline.
